How to cook carrots perfectly

For sweetness:
Roast or glaze carrots with honey, citrus, butter or olive oil. Cooking concentrates their natural sugars and gives them a tender texture.

For crunch:
Use raw grated or shaved carrots in salads, coleslaw, wraps and fresh bowls.

For creaminess:
Blend cooked carrots into soup, hummus, purée or sauces. They create a smooth texture without needing many ingredients.

For baking:
Grate carrots finely so they melt into cakes, muffins and cookies while keeping the crumb moist.
